Transform Conflict with Curiosity: Moving Beyond Defensiveness in Relationships
This episode delves into the concept of defensiveness in relationships and its impact on connection. The speaker shares personal experiences and professional insights to illustrate how defensiveness can escalate conflicts by protecting one's ego, rather than the relationship. Instead, the speaker advocates for using curiosity as an antidote to defensiveness. By asking open-ended questions and seeking to understand the other person's perspective, we can create a safer space for both parties. This approach helps in de-escalating tension and fostering empathy, ultimately strengthening the relationship. Practical steps and real-life examples are provided to guide listeners in applying these principles to their own conflicts.
